Headquartered in Lakeville, Minn., Post Consumer Brands, a business unit of Post Holdings, Inc., is dedicated to providing people and their pets with delicious food choices for every taste and budget. The company's portfolio includes beloved brands such as Honey Bunches of Oats, PEBBLES, Grape-Nuts and Malt-O-Meal cereal and Peter Pan peanut butter, as well as Rachael Ray Nutrish, Kibbles 'n Bits and 9
Lives dog and cat food. Post also provides private label solutions to customers in pet food, cereal, nut butters and granola. As a company committed to high standards of quality and to our values, we are driven by one idea:
To make lives better by making delicious food accessible for all. For more information about our brands, visit and follow us on Linked In or Facebook for the latest news.
Location Description
The Lawrence, Kansas facility is 236,000 square feet and home to about 155 hard working team members who are proud to produce iconic pet food brands like Kibbles 'n Bits. Lawrence is a college town and the home to both the University of Kansas and Haskell Indian Nations University with Kansas State University about 85 miles away. The city is known for a thriving music and art scene and is also the home of the University of Kansas athletic teams.

About the Role
The Senior Capital Engineering Project Manager provides engineering project management and technical services to support manufacturing facilities. You'll develop and implement capital projects, lead teams and contractors, and help plan for the future-always with a focus on safety, food safety, quality, and the environment.
Key Responsibilities
* Lead capital engineering projects from concept through design, construction, and start-up, managing scope, schedule, cost, and quality.
* Manage multiple complex, multi-million-dollar projects, including budgets, resources, contractors, and external engineering partners.
* Develop and evaluate project options, feasibility studies, and cost-benefit analyses to support sound business decisions.
* Partner with cross-functional teams and executives to align on project goals, plans, and priorities - communicating early and often.
* Ensure all projects meet safety, food safety, quality, environmental, regulatory, and GMP standards.
* Identify and deliver capital projects that reduce cost, improve operations, and support long-term business strategy.
Qualifications
What We're Looking For
Required
* Bachelor's degree in Engineering
* 10+ years of experience in a process environment including project management, process/facility design, and contractor management.
* Proven leadership of large, complex, multi-million-dollar projects from concept through completion.
* Strong knowledge across multiple engineering and construction disciplines, plus plant operations.
* Ability to build and lead effective project teams (internal and external) to define scope and deliver results.
* Strong analytical, scheduling, and planning skills; comfort making decisions with limited information.
Preferred
* Processing/manufacturing experience.
* Graduate studies in business, management, or engineering.
* PMP certification and/or PE license.
Location & Travel
* Location:
Lakeville, MN (Hybrid)
* Travel:
Significant travel (30-50%) will be required to support project management activities across facilities.
